Transaction 38abdee233205176ea1a35c81dc2dfcbabd20931f4077efe0e149bc7e6a5d69f

1 Input
2 Outputs
  • 38abdee233205176ea1a35c81dc2dfcbabd20931f4077efe0e149bc7e6a5d69f:0
  • value  31000000
    address  3MH94WmdVpKGEDTWFVEEpdCE9NDSXkmTys
  • 38abdee233205176ea1a35c81dc2dfcbabd20931f4077efe0e149bc7e6a5d69f:1
  • value  1970000
    address  3GpGgT3sFxcBtt6JZRG3Kn7N4JfmsszXy6